117.info
人生若只如初见

sql中nvl函数的用法是什么

在 SQL 中,NVL 函数用于检查一个表达式是否为 NULL,并在该表达式为 NULL 时返回另一个指定的值。它的基本语法如下:

NVL(expr1, expr2)

其中,expr1 是要检查是否为 NULL 的表达式,expr2 是当 expr1 为 NULL 时返回的值。

NVL 函数的作用是将 NULL 值替换为其他非 NULL 值,从而避免在计算或比较中引发错误。它通常用于 SELECT 语句中,例如:

SELECT NVL(column_name, ‘Replacement Value’) FROM table_name;

这将返回 column_name 列中的值,如果该值为 NULL,则返回 ‘Replacement Value’。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e222AzsLAwNXBlQ.html

推荐文章

  • SQL语句报错ORA-00936: missing expression

    ORA-00936: missing expression错误是指在SQL语句中缺少了表达式(expression)或存在语法错误。这个错误可能发生在以下情况下: SELECT语句中缺少了表达式:

  • SQL中join的用法解析

    在SQL中,JOIN用于将两个或多个表中的数据连接在一起,以便可以在一个查询中同时检索和操作这些表中的数据。
    JOIN操作基于两个表之间的关系进行,这些关系可...

  • 怎么用sql创建表设置主键自增

    你可以使用以下语法来创建一个表并设置主键自增:
    CREATE TABLE table_name ( column1 datatype PRIMARY KEY AUTO_INCREMENT, column2 datatype, column3 d...

  • 怎么用sql语句设置字段自增

    要设置字段自增,可以使用SQL语句中的AUTO_INCREMENT属性。以下是使用不同数据库系统的示例:
    MySQL和MariaDB:
    CREATE TABLE table_name ( column_na...

  • win10设备管理器不停的刷新如何解决

    如果您的Windows 10设备管理器不停地刷新,可能是由于以下原因: 驱动程序问题:尝试更新设备的驱动程序,可以在设备管理器中右键单击设备并选择“更新驱动程序”...

  • win11电脑闪屏刷新问题怎么解决

    解决Win11电脑闪屏刷新问题的方法可以尝试以下几种: 更新显卡驱动程序:使用最新的显卡驱动程序,可以通过显卡厂商的官方网站或Windows更新来获取驱动程序的最新...

  • c#中server.mappath的作用是什么

    在C#中,Server.MapPath()方法用于获取指定相对路径的物理路径。它将返回一个字符串,表示在服务器上的文件或目录的物理路径。
    作用: 通过将相对路径作为参...

  • sql语句decode函数怎么使用

    在SQL中,DECODE函数用于在一组条件中进行选择。它类似于其他编程语言中的switch语句。下面是使用DECODE函数的语法:
    DECODE(expression, value1, result1,...